aspx文件有如下一行代码:

<%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Notify.aspx.cs" Inherits="JFTNotify.Notify" %>

ASP.NET 页面中的前几行,一般是%@...%这样的代码,这叫做页面指令。用来定义ASP.NET页分析器和编译器使用的特定于该页得一些定义。在.aspx文件中使用的页面指令一般有以下几种:

(1)Language: 指定页中的所有内联呈现(<%%>和<%=%>)和代码声名块进行编译时使用的语言。可以是任何.NET Framework支持的语言。请切记:每页只能使用和指定一种语言,但一个工程可以使用多种语言。

(2)AutoEventWireup : 设置页面的事件是否自动绑定。ASP.NET 2.0默认值为true,ASP.NET 1.0和ASP.NET 1.1默认为false。ASP.NET页触发的事件,如Init, Load,PreRender等,在默认情况下,可以使用“Page_事件名称”的命名约定将页事件绑定到相应的方法,页面编译时,ASP.NET将查找基础此命名约定的方法,并自动执行该方法的代码。例如,页的Load事件默认创建名为Page_Load的方法处理程序。

(3)CodeFile:指定指向页引用的代码隐藏文件的路径。此属性与Inherits属性一起使用可以将代码隐藏源文件与网页相关联。此属性仅对编译的页有效。

(4)Inherits:与CodeFile属性(包含指向代码隐藏类的源文件的路径)一起使用来定义供页继承的任何从Page类派生的代码隐藏类。(其实就是指定了要执行的代码在aspx.cs文件中的位置)

(5)session:session="false",页面不保存session。

(6)contentType:contentType="text/html; charset=UTF-8" :指定编码方式。

更多详情请看:https://blog.csdn.net/u010678947/article/details/19974217

最新文章

  1. QR code 扩展生成二维码
  2. VC++ 19 (VS2015) 编译器系统环境变量配置
  3. NHibernate可视化设计插件——Mindscape.NHibernateModelDesigner
  4. CLR via C#(03)- 对象创建和类型转换
  5. Linux下文件重命名、创建、删除、修改及保存文件
  6. 如何用手机维护Mysql数据库
  7. 安装ADT Cannot complete the install because one or more required items could not be found.
  8. CodeForces Round #286 Div.2
  9. 一个ASPX页面的生命周期?
  10. js提取整数部分,移除首末空格
  11. Maven 打包到Tomcat下
  12. 利用bind搭建dns
  13. rtems在mini2440上的移植(ubuntu)
  14. experiment 3
  15. 常用git命令总结 初始化git库操作 git 子模块
  16. 校内模拟赛 虫洞(by NiroBC)
  17. angular2+中数据变更子组件页面未更新
  18. JavaScript工具函数集
  19. 如何在ubuntu上搭建hustoj?
  20. 关于List、Map循环时,进行删除的结论

热门文章

  1. Omi框架学习之旅 - 通过对象实例来实现组件通讯 及原理说明
  2. 11-(基础入门篇)WiFi模块开发,下载运行第一个程序
  3. Recurrent Neural Network[CTC]
  4. 浅谈传感器常用Delta-SigmaADC
  5. BZOJ4911: [Sdoi2017]切树游戏
  6. Ionic App之国际化(2) json数组的处理
  7. 面试3——java集合类总结(Map)
  8. 微信小程序:java后台获取openId
  9. Opencv 2.4.10 +VS2010 项目配置
  10. VS2015 搭建 Asp.net core 开发环境